Output bfbc3255006465cd242bd285e88c84db0e955292f52a0ef98146ac0e183dc60e:1

value
17516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0da3e11944c735cc79a737e8c2a99d030adc9980 OP_EQUAL
address
32w92a2xZDEweMo7hDQX2zhRiJ3dpQqc9h
transaction
bfbc3255006465cd242bd285e88c84db0e955292f52a0ef98146ac0e183dc60e
confirmations
192681
spent
true